Transaction 8034324becf51147c24cc9852b940c3e87182268e0a8e887a3361cc79782bdbb
1 Input
1 Output
-
8034324becf51147c24cc9852b940c3e87182268e0a8e887a3361cc79782bdbb: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 beedc6dc2377b2cbcf258a280be8bfad17d3ccdc89368d26cb7c492630bbbb1d
- address
- bc1phmkudhprw7evhne93g5qh69l45ta8nxu3ymg6fkt03yjvv9mhvwsvuk06w